Boys & Girls: J30 Weybridge, GB - grass (week 29)


A nice grass court domestic event  

BOYS

All-Brit quarter-finals  

QFs:

(1) Preston Taylor def. (6) Ollie Knight  6-3 6-3

(8) Oliver Page def. (4) Casey Drake  6-1  4-6  6-2

Archie Gray def. (q) Casey Unitt 6-3 6-3 

(5) Alex Mirrington def. (3) Jesse Clarkson 6-4 6-4

GIRLS

QFs:

(1) Rosie Cho def. (q) Olivia Kaser (AUT) 6-3 6-0

(3) Marfa Solovei (AUS) def. Izzy Burrow 5-7 6-1 6-3

(wc) Dasha Jones def. (7) Martha Ground 6-2 6-1

(wc) Adaugo Nwogu def. Sophie Johnstone 1-6 6-2 7-6(5)


Rosie is 15 years old

Dasha and Adaugo are both 13 years old - so a special well done to them

this is the second only ITF event for both of them

Girls Singles: (1) Rosie Cho def. (wc) Dasha Jones 6-7(5) 7-5 6-0



Girls Dubs: Rosie & Marfa (AUS) won 6-0 6-2




Boys singles: (8) Oliver Page def. Archie Gray 6-4 6-2



Boys Dubs: Archie & Oliver won 5-7 6-3 10-3
